What is Customs Order Form
The Customs Clearance Order Form is a business form used by vendors and exhibitors to arrange customs clearance and transportation services for shipments to events in Canada.

What is the Customs Clearance Order Form?
The Customs Clearance Order Form is essential for exhibitors and vendors participating in events in Canada. This form serves to streamline the customs clearance process and ensure effective transportation logistics. By providing detailed information about shipments, it helps in facilitating smooth customs procedures and timely delivery of materials to various events.
Exhibitors use the customs clearance order form to navigate international shipping requirements, making it an invaluable tool in event logistics.

Key Features of the Customs Clearance Order Form
The Customs Clearance Order Form includes several mandatory fields that are crucial for effective logistics. Users must provide detailed information such as 'Exhibitor / Company Name', 'Event Name', and payment information. Accurate data entry is vital for seamless customs clearance and transportation.
-
'U.S. Tax # or U.S. IRS Identification'
-
'Facility Name' and 'Event Date/s'
-
'Shipping details' such as weights and carton counts.
Who Needs the Customs Clearance Order Form?
The primary users of the Customs Clearance Order Form include exhibitors, vendors, and event organizers. These stakeholders rely on accurate submissions to ensure smooth operations during events. The accounting manager plays a critical role, as they are tasked with authorizing the form for payment processing.

Who is eligible to use the Customs Clearance Order Form?
This form is designed for exhibitors and vendors seeking customs clearance and transportation services for shipping goods to events in Canada. An accounting manager must complete and sign the form to authorize payment.
What information do I need to complete the Customs Clearance Order Form?
You will need detailed information about your company, shipment, and event including tax identification numbers, shipping dates, and credit card details for payment processing.
How do I submit the completed Customs Clearance Order Form?
The form can be submitted electronically through pdfFiller by downloading it after completion or sending it via email, depending on the recipient's requests.
Is notarization required for the Customs Clearance Order Form?
No, notarization is not required for the Customs Clearance Order Form. It needs to be signed by the accounting manager only.
